Merge PDF on iPhone, iPad
- Open the Files app on your iOS device and locate the PDF files you want to merge.
- Tap Select at the top > mark the PDF files > tap the three-dots icon in the bottom-right corner > tap Create PDF. That’s it.

How do I sync PDF Expert between iPhone and iPad?
To upload files from your iOS device using another cloud:
- Open PDF Expert, tapat the top right > Select .
- Select the files you want to synchronize.
- Tap More on the toolbar at the bottom.
- Select Upload > your cloud storage for sync.
- Tap Upload at the top right.

How do I sync PDF between Mac and iPad?
Sync books between your Mac and iPhone or iPad
- Connect your device to your Mac.
- In the Finder on your Mac, select the device in the Finder sidebar.
- Click Books in the button bar.
- Select the “Sync books onto [device name]” checkbox to turn on syncing of your books.

How do you multitask on iPad 15?
Here’s how to get started.
- Launch an app.
- Tap the three-dot Multitasking button.
- Tap the Split View button. The current app moves aside and your Home Screen appears.
- Tap a second app on your Home Screen.
- If you chose Split View, the second app appears side-by-side with the current app on an evenly divided screen.

How do I just save one page of a PDF?
How To Save a Single Page of a PDF
- Open the PDF file in your PDF editor.
- Click File > Print.
- Choose the page you want to save from the PDF file.
- Click PDF > Save As PDF.
- Choose where to save the file.
- Click Save.
- Your one page PDF is now saved in a new location.
Can you send just one page of a PDF?
If you are using a Windows computer, you can split a PDF file for free. You start by opening the PDF file using the Edge browser. You click the three dots in the top right corner and select Print. In the drop-down menu, select “Save as PDF.” Under “Pages,” you can type a specific page or multiple pages.
